Description
'Twin Light Diazinon 14% Granular' is an insecticide and miticide. Its Federal EPA registration number is: 1159-195. It was originally approved by EPA on 02 Oct 1975. Its registration got cancelled on 30 Sep 1991. It has a 'Caution' signal word. It has the following active ingredients: Diazinon. It's approved for 1 sites including dichondra. It is also approved for 10 pests and pest groups including but not limited to ants, chiggers, clover mite, european chafer, fleas, hyperodes weevils, japanese beetle, lawn chinch bugs, sod webworms, and southern masked chafer.
